2- SAFETY INSTRUCTIONS
QUANTUM TOUCH
2.5 General
Keep sucient space around the dispenser to get away easily in case of hot
liquid splashes.
The liquids delivered by the dispenser are hot! Avoid scalding! Keep hands and
other body parts away from the dispenser while drinks are being dispensed and
during the rinsing program.
Warning
This appliance can be used by children aged from 8 years and above and persons
with reduced physical, sensory or mental capabilities or lack of experience and
knowledge if they have been given supervision or instruction concerning use of
the appliance in a safe way and understand the hazards involved. Children shall
not play with the appliance. Cleaning and user maintenance shall not be made by
children without supervision.
Place the dispenser on a table or counter with a minimum height of 60 cm/24 in
to avoid that young children can press a drink button.
Do not place cups, pots, or containers lled with hot liquids on top of the dispenser.
There is the risk of being scalded, in case the cups/pots/ containers fall down.
Keep ventilation openings, in the appliance enclosure or in the built-in structure,
clear of obstruction.
Do not use mechanical devices or other means to accelerate the defrosting
process, other than those recommended by the manufacturer.
Do not damage the refrigerant circuit.
Do not use electrical appliances inside the food storage compartments of the
appliance, unless they are of the type recommended by the manufacturer.
When positioning the appliance, ensure the supply cord is not trapped or damaged.
Do not locate multiple portable socket-outlets or portable power supplies at the
rear of the appliance.
Do not store explosive substances such as aerosol cans with a ammable
propellant in this appliance.
